Wpis z mikrobloga

Mirki... mam problem z iteratorem w rangeloop w #cpp.
Mianowicie...
Mam klasę abstrakcyjną Object.
3 klasy dziedziczą po Object: StringObject, IntObject, DoubleObject.
Utworzyłem do tego listę, która przetrzymuje wskaźniki do obiektów typu Object.
Następnie utworzyłem zagnieżdżoną klasę iterator w klasie List i tu zaczynają sie problemy...

Gdy wrzucę mojego iteratora do pętli for(;;) to wszystko działa, natomiast gdy wrzucę ją do pętli range
loop, wyrzuca mi błąd, który nie do końca rozumiem, bo dlaczego chce Object konwertować do iteratora?

Tutaj zamieszczam kod, ale wszystko wrzuciłem do jednego pliku, więc może być on trudny do przejrzenia xD

#programowanie #cplusplus
OstryKepucz - Mirki... mam problem z iteratorem w rangeloop w #cpp.
Mianowicie...
M...

źródło: comment_OKUHGtznlzQym70GPFyB4geNLWaRwzlM.jpg

Pobierz
  • 22
  • Odpowiedz
  • Otrzymuj powiadomienia
    o nowych komentarzach